To prevent wheel spin in the lower gears, and to reduce the stresses on some components, the engine management system alters the torque characteristics of the engine, depending on which gear is chosen.
BTW - This happens in all new Fords, the power is limited by the Calibration in the ECU in First and Second gear which stops wheel spinning and also prolongs the life of the gearbox.
